Darling Diva: Anna

Anna was created for Darling Diva's friend Anna who has a nail blog called Going to the Showing. The polish was created to show Carrie's gratitude to Anna for always being supportive and helping her to make her product better:)

I think it was such a sweet gesture and the polish is a stunner! Have a look:



Carrie from Darling Diva says that this polish is a combination of 3 different blue glitters (in 3 different sizes) both metallic and holographic.



In my photos, Anna is layered in three coats to build opacity and depth. Anna would also be pretty worn over navy, royal blue, indigo or dark purple. Maybe even a hot pink!?



There is nothing more satisfying about polish than seeing it glimmer and twinkle in the sunlight and this polish definitely has that wow factor!



Anna was really easy to apply and control, no dabbing or digging. It dried fast and had a smooth glassy finish.

Vivid Lacquer: St. Patrick's Day Duo

This evening I have two polishes from Vivid Lacquer to share with you! One is a jelly and the other is a holo glitter topper! The duo was created for St. Patrick's day and will be released Monday, March 4th.

Leprechaun Dust is the first polish in the set. Its a medium green jelly packed with iridescent shimmer and hexes.



I wore three thin coats for the photos here, but I think two heavier coats would cover the nail line.



The application of Leprechaun Dust was excellent. I was able to control where I wanted the polish on the nail; very little clean up needed.



I would love this polish even if it didn't have the shimmers and hex glitters in it. Such a pretty shade of green, like a shamrock!



Next, I topped it with Rainbow's End, a gold "coin", small gold glitter and lime green holo glitter topper.



I wore one coat and used a kind of brush/dab technique to apply it. I think its the perfect amount of glitter to allow the base color to show through.



Gah! I just love circle glitter! Pretty clever idea to use it in this polish!



Such a festive fun glitter; I think it suits the occasion really well!
